Christianjohn

A compound name combining Christian (from Latin Christianus, 'follower of Christ') with John (from Hebrew Yochanan, meaning 'God is gracious'). This merged name reflects modern parental practice of honoring multiple family names or values by blending them into a single, distinctive given name.
